Yankees pitcher Domingo German suspended for 81 games

Domingo German, one of the breakout stars of the 2019 Yankees, has been suspended for 81 games for violating MLB’s domestic violence policy.  German will serve the remaining 63 games this season, as the suspension is retroactive to last season.  German served the first 18 games of the suspension during the 2019 season, including the Yankees’ nine postseason games.

German’s suspension stems from an incident that allegedly happened after C.C. Sabathia’s Gala in September.  The incident allegedly happened at the home of German and his girlfriend in Westchester County.

German will not appeal the discipline, which also includes participation in an evaluation and treatment program supervised by MLB’s Joint Policy Board. He also has agreed to make a contribution to Sanctuary for Families, a New York City-based nonprofit organization dedicated to aiding victims of domestic violence.
